Integration can be used to model the volume of air inhaled during breathing. The respiratory cycle is the repeating intake and expulsion of air, and it usually lasts about five seconds. By treating airflow as a function of time, students can see how the amount of air in the lungs changes during a breath.

呼吸是一个周期性过程,每个完整的呼吸周期大约持续5秒。
目标是求出在此呼吸周期中任意时刻 t 肺部吸入空气的体积。
气流速率随时间变化,可用正弦函数进行建模。结果显示,气流在吸气中期达到峰值,并在呼气时发生反向,最大速率约为 0.5 L/s。
微小时间 dt 内的无穷小体积 dV 通过对从 0 到 t 的气流速率进行积分,累积为总的吸入体积。
代换法通过将变量 u 设为 2πx 除以 5 来简化积分。微分 dx 用 du 表示,以匹配新变量。积分限也相应改变,变为从 0 到 2πt 除以 5。
